About Proto-A-Thon 2026

We are pleased to announce our upcoming International Prototype Design Competition, “Proto-A-Thon 2026”. This competition focuses on digital innovation and user-centered design with the theme “Transforming Food Supply Chains with Innovative Digital Experiences”, in collaboration with ID FOOD, Indonesia’s state-owned food holding company.

Participants will be challenged to design digital solutions that improve the efficiency, transparency, and user experience within the food ecosystem, covering areas such as production, distribution, logistics, and consumption.

The competition consists of two rounds:

Preliminary Round
In the preliminary round, each registered team will be given a real-world case related to the food supply chain ecosystem. Teams are required to analyze the problem and propose a solution in the form of a Pitch Deck (maximum 25 slides).

Final Round
The final round will be held in a hybrid format, where the top 10 selected teams will advance to compete. During this stage, teams will participate in a 12-hour live prototyping challenge, where they will refine and develop their solution into a high-quality prototype using tools such as Figma or other design platforms.

Proto-A-Thon 2026 emphasizes innovation, user experience, and real-world impact, encouraging participants to create meaningful digital solutions for a more efficient and sustainable food ecosystem.
